> The [doc|https://docs.oracle.com/database/121/DWHSG/pattern.htm#DWHSG8986]
> has already defined pattern operator {{Concatenation}}. For example, pattern
> {{A B}} means that events matching pattern {{A}} and {{B}} should occur
> successively. There are also many use cases which require patterns to match
> events which not occur successively.
